funclang's Introduction

funclang

A small functional language interpreter similar to Haskell implemented in python and ANTLR4, done just for self-learning.

Syntax

basic assignment

a = 1;

function declaration

f(x): x + 1;

Conditional, x == 0 is False, x != 0 is True.

f(x): x ? 1 : 0;

statement groups, the result of the expression is the result of the last statement

a = {x=1;x};

Lists

a = [1,2,3];

All functions return a value, even builtin functions. Assignment returns always 1. print returns always 1. One difference with Haskell is there is no pattern matching.

Operators

  • +, -, *, /, **: arithmetic operators
  • |, &, ^: bitwise/boolean operators
  • ~: 2 complement.
  • !: logical negation.
  • $: convert a list into parameters for a function.
  • >,>=,<,<=,==: comparation.
  • (expr) ? (expr1) : (expr2) : if/else
  • #: start comment line.

Built-in functions

  • split(list) returns the list splitted into head and tail
  • map(func, list) returns the mapping of a function over a list
  • print(...) prints parameters

Some examples:

x(a,b): a + b; 
print(x(1,2));

fib(x): x <= 1 ? x : (fib(x-1)+fib(x-2));
print(fib(5),fib(6),fib(7),fib(8));

recursively walk through lists

printlines(x): 
    x ? { h, t = split(x) ; print(x) ; printlines(x) }
      : 1;

items=[1,2,3,4,5,6];
printlines(items);

# passing list as parameters
do_something(a,b,c,d,e,f,g): 1

do_something($items);

Functions as first class objects

x(a,b): a + b;
z(f,a,b): f(a,b);
print("function as first class object:",z(x,1,2));

More on Lists

max(x): x 
    ? { h,t=split(x); m=max(t); h > m ? h : m } 
    : 0;

sum(x) : x ? {h,t=split(x); h+sum(t)} : 0;

print(max(items));
print(sum(items));
